Being a Brit of German-Italian parents I'm pretty interested in what's going on on the European music scene but get a bit frustrated with many people here who think Europe's contribution to pop and rock are dodgy imitations of US and UK rock bands with bad mullets and fluffy pop plus ABBA. Shame is that US and UK get most of the credit for being the main movers. What's the view of the European scene in US and Canada?

Things is you can pretty much credit German bands with inventing the whole electronic music genre with acts like Kraftwerk, Neu, Tangerine Dream, Can, Faust. 2 of the most interesting outfits ive ever come across are Swiss, Young Gods and Yello. the french scene is really vibrant right now esp. with the electronic jazz vibe with acts like St Germain
